Q1. What makes Philadelphia Learning Academy – West different?
Ans. The school provides a different approach to education, with flexible learning options and personalized student support.
Q2. Does the school have credit recovery options?
Ans. Students may be able to participate in credit recovery programs to meet graduation requirements.
Q3. Do you provide counseling and mentoring services?
Ans. Yes, students have access to academic counseling, mentoring and personal support services.
Q4. What kind of extracurricular activities do you have?
Ans. Students can join clubs, leadership activities and enrichment programs provided by the school.
Q5. What does the school do to help students succeed?
Ans. The school provides individual instruction, academic intervention, counseling and graduation readiness programs to assist students.
